Output 8685d379332bc6d39188001d5a49036212a12378dd52b80f4f1aa7c7feff1b9e:8

value
422282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72579f8af24c697c42b00f658020d5b8a74bc946 OP_EQUAL
address
3C7bvabZeLTsW5Z85SjQ52PvgB2aHY779D
transaction
8685d379332bc6d39188001d5a49036212a12378dd52b80f4f1aa7c7feff1b9e
spent
true